Output 75fb6a6de71d0c11928c23de69c866d66bfd2d9c62705882068350d79321835c:0

value
360631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 516c691f4656ab003a860df9c61dd4d05443f059 OP_EQUAL
address
397YXasofEW6FMTzUbaMHXpNoEPauEaevN
transaction
75fb6a6de71d0c11928c23de69c866d66bfd2d9c62705882068350d79321835c
spent
true